BEVERLY, Mass. - Endicott College middle blocker A.J. Witkofsky (Scotia, N.Y.) has been named the North East Collegiate Volleyball Association's New England Player of the Week. The Endicott sophomore put together an impressive three matches, leading the Gulls to a perfect 3-0 mark last week.
In a come-from-behind win over 14th-ranked Rivier, Witkofsky smashed 26 kills and seven total blocks in the five-game victory. A.J. also had 17 kills and seven total blocks in a three-game sweep of playoff-bound Elms College on Saturday. For the week, A.J. posted 53 kills, 24 digs and 20 total blocks, all while swinging .471% with only 12 errors.
Endicott will return to action on Monday night as the Gulls host the University of New Haven for a 7:00 p.m. match in Beverly, Mass.
